Water pooling prevention services focus on identifying and addressing areas where excess water tends to collect around a property. These services typically involve assessing the landscape, grading, and drainage systems to ensure water flows away from foundations, walkways, and other critical areas. Professionals may recommend installing or repairing drainage solutions such as gutters, downspouts, drain tiles, or grading adjustments to facilitate proper water runoff. The goal is to create an effective water management plan that minimizes standing water and prevents potential damage caused by water accumulation.

Pooling water around a property can lead to several issues, including foundation problems, soil erosion, and the growth of mold or mildew. Excess water can weaken the structural integrity of a building’s foundation over time, leading to costly repairs and potential safety hazards. Additionally, standing water can create muddy or slippery surfaces, increasing the risk of accidents. Water pooling can also attract pests such as mosquitoes, which breed in stagnant water. Implementing pooling prevention measures helps mitigate these risks by directing water away from vulnerable areas and maintaining proper drainage.

The overview below groups typical Water Pooling Prevention proj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Independence,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Inspection and Assessment - Typically costs between $150 and $400 for a comprehensive site evaluation to identify pooling risks and drainage issues. Examples include detailed inspections of slopes, gutters, and drainage systems.

Drainage System Installation - The cost for installing new drainage solutions generally ranges from $1,000 to $4,000, depending on the size of the area and complexity. This may include French drains, channel drains, or sump pumps.

Surface Grading and Re-sloping - Regrading projects usually fall within a $2,000 to $6,000 price range, based on property size and soil conditions. Proper grading helps divert water away from the pool area effectively.

Waterproofing and Sealing - Applying waterproof coatings or sealants can cost between $500 and $2,500, depending on the extent of the area and materials used. This service helps prevent water infiltration around the pool perimeter.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es water pooling around my property? Water pooling can result from poor drainage, uneven terrain, or blocked gutters, leading to excess water accumulation after rain.

How can water pooling affect my property? Persistent pooling can lead to foundation issues, soil erosion, and increased risk of water intrusion into basements or crawl spaces.

What services are available to prevent water pooling? Local service providers offer drainage solutions, grading, and installation of drainage systems to help redirect water away from structures.

How do drainage solutions work to prevent pooling? These solutions improve water flow by directing excess water to appropriate drainage areas, reducing accumulation around the property.
